Provides instruction and supervision in a safe and healthy learning environment for PREK Counts children. Provides and coordinates education services; works in partnership with parents to promote the social, emotional, physical, and cognitive development of PREK Counts children. Encourages parent involvement in all aspects of the program. Schedules educational parent teacher conferences. Develops and implements classroom curriculum to provide learning opportunities for individual child goals, provides on-going assessment on progress and facilitates transition to kindergarten. Works toward compliance in all facets of Pennsylvania Pre-Kindergarten program performance standards and regulations.
E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E:
REQUIRED:
· Baccalaureate degree or Associate's degree from an accredited college with an early childhood education major and educational certification OR willingness to pursue the required baccalaureate degree and certification.
· 2 Years classroom experience.
· Experience working with low-income families desired.
· Prior to hiring, able to meet State ECE hiring requirements, including clear background checks, Bi-Annual physical examination, and negative TB test
· College transcripts must be provided at the time of application or prior to job offer to ensure compliance with PREK Counts Regulations.
PREFERRED:
Level 1 or Level 2 Educational Certification
K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ILITIES:
Must have the demonstrated ability to direct the activities of others; provide training and communicate effectively, both orally and in writing. Bilingual (Spanish/English) preferred.
Little People’s Village is a high quality child care center and summer camp facility located in the historic Overbrook neighborhood of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. We offer Infant through school age care. We service families and children in the Philadelphia area as well as parts of Delaware county and the Main Line region. Little People’s Village originally opened 11 years ago as a small home-based daycare facility and many of our staff members from the very beginning are still with us today.
